  3. needing some advice on my jetting. i ride in elevations around 1500ft. temp is usually around 70 - 90 degree. i just need some advice on if i need to bump up my jetting. 01 banshee with t5 pipes, air filter, white bros boost bottle, tors removed. it's suppose to be stock bore. and carbs are stock 26mm mikuni the current jets are 200 main, and 2.8 pilots.
